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Elijah Newman's "Distance" speak to the complex and often tumultuous nature of relationships, specifically the relationship between brothers or close friends. The first verse, "Put away your guns, and I'll put away mine // No matter what you say, just give it to me straight // You told me you would do all you could // To keep me alive, and stay by my side // And I won't let you out of my life," highlights the importance of open communication and honesty in any relationship. The singer acknowledges that both parties have likely been hurt or defensive in the past, but pleads for a fresh start and a commitment to stay present for each other.


The second verse, "Brother you're my friend, ought to be my kin // But sometimes I feel, that you're distant still // Just keep your head high, and I swear we'll get by // Think with your heart, and we'll make a new start // And I won't let you out of my life," delves deeper into the singer's feelings of distance and disconnection. He recognizes that his friend and brother should be closer to him, but there is still a lingering gap between them. The singer encourages his friend to stay positive and optimistic, and to listen to his heart to make a change. The repetition of the line "And I won't let you out of my life" serves as a reminder of the singer's unwavering commitment to the relationship, despite any past or present difficulties.


The chorus, "And we will rise up // And we will come up // Out of these graves // The ones we have made," is a powerful declaration of hope and resilience. The singer acknowledges that both parties have made mistakes in the past, creating "graves" that they now must climb out of. However, the use of "we" suggests a partnership and a mutual desire to move forward and make things right.


Overall, "Distance" is a poignant and emotional song that speaks to the ups and downs of friendship and brotherhood. It highlights the importance of honesty, communication, and forgiveness, and encourages listeners to stay committed to the people they care about.
